Tax obligation decrease in the USA The USA taxes people and residents on their globally earnings. Citizens and locals living and functioning outside the united state may be entitled to a foreign made earnings exclusion that minimizes gross income. For 2025, the maximum exclusion is $130,000 per taxpayer (future years indexed for inflation)Additionally, the taxpayer should satisfy either of 2 tests:: the taxpayer was a bona fide local of an international country for a period that consists of a complete U.S. tax obligation year, or: the taxpayer needs to be physically present in an international nation (or nations) for a minimum of 330 complete days in any 12-month duration that begins or finishes in the tax obligation year concerned.
Better, the examination is not satisfied if the taxpayer states to the foreign government that they are not a tax obligation resident of that country. Such statement can be on visa applications or income tax return, or enforced as a condition of a visa. Qualification for the exclusion may be influenced by some tax treaties.
The exclusion is limited to income made by a taxpayer for efficiency of solutions outside the U.S.

The FEIE is a major tax break for expats that permits Americans to omit a certain quantity of their international made earnings from regular federal earnings taxes. The various other essential tax obligation breaks for expats consist of the Foreign Tax obligation Credit (FTC) and Foreign Housing Exclusion/Deduction (FHE/FHD), both of which we'll go into even more detail on later on.

It does not, however, omit your earnings from various other sorts of taxes. Independent expats that declare the FEIE must still pay a tax obligation of 15.3% (12.4% for Social Security, 2.9% for Medicare) on their internet self-employment earnings. Keep in mind: Americans working abroad for US-based employers are in charge of simply 7.65% in United States Social Safety and security tax obligations, as their employers are called for to cover the other 7.65%.
You can not make contributions to tax-advantaged US retirement accounts from revenue excluded under the FEIE. Before you assert the FEIE, you must satisfy at the very least a couple of different examinations. To meet the Physical Existence Examination, you have to be physically existing in a foreign country (or countries) for at the very least 330 complete days out of any365-day period that overlaps the pertinent tax year.
Keep in mind that only days where you spent all 24 hours outside of the United States count as a complete day for the objectives of this test. Showing you satisfied the Physical Presence test needs you to log every one of the nations you were literally present in over the appropriate 365-day duration and just how much time you spent there.
